OK3576-C SBC
Octa-Core CPU with 8K Video Decoding
RK3576 is a high-performance, low-power AIoT processor from Rockchip. It integrates an octa-core CPU (4×Cortex-A72 + 4×Cortex-A53) and a 6TOPS NPU. The architecture features an embedded 3D GPU and a dedicated 2D hardware engine with MMU for optimized display performance, supporting H.265 8K Ultra HD hardware decoding.
True Hardware Isolation
The RK3576 features a hardware Firewall to manage access permissions between the master and peripherals/memory, ensuring hardware resource isolation. This enhances system stability and security across diverse application scenarios.
6 TOPS NPU for AI Acceleration
6TOPS super-computing power NPU, support INT4/INT8/INT16/FP16/BF16/TF32 operation, support dual-core work together or work independently, support multi-task, multi-scenario parallel, support deep learning frameworks: TensorFlow, Caffe, Tflite, Pytorch, Onnx NN, Android NN, etc.
Ultra Clear Display + AI Intelligent Repair
Supports H.264/H.265 encoding and decoding with five output interfaces: HDMI/eDP, MIPI DSI, Parallel, EBC, and DP. It enables triple-screen independent display at 4K@120Hz, featuring super-resolution and intelligent image enhancement (de-blurring & frame rate upscaling) for diverse scenarios.
New Parallel FlexBus Interface
FlexBus: A flexible parallel interface supporting 2/4/8/16-bit data transmission at up to 100MHz, capable of emulating standard or custom protocols. The RK3576 also integrates extensive connectivity, including DSMC, CAN-FD, PCIe 2.1, SATA 3.0, USB 3.2, SAI, I2C, I3C, and UART.

Note(1) Video Port
Video Port0: up to 4K@120Hz, 10 bits;
Video Port1: up to 2560x1600@60Hz, 10 bits;
Video Port2: up to 1920x1080@60Hz, 8 bits
Each interface can be connected to HDMI/eDP/DSI-2
Port1 and Port2 can be connected to serial output interface
Note(2): single TDM clock up to 50MHz, when working with TDM mode, it can work together with audio sampling frame rate and resolution to compute supported audio channels
